Skip to content

Commit

Permalink
Merge pull request #1 from SomeRandomiOSDev/SwiftPackages
Browse files Browse the repository at this point in the history
Added support for Swift Packages
  • Loading branch information
SomeRandomiOSDev committed Jun 10, 2019
2 parents cb6936e + e963ac6 commit 1fd367e
Show file tree
Hide file tree
Showing 6 changed files with 35 additions and 12 deletions.
1 change: 1 addition & 0 deletions .gitignore
@@ -1,2 +1,3 @@
ReadWriteLock.xcodeproj/project.xcworkspace
ReadWriteLock.xcodeproj/xcuserdata
.build
22 changes: 22 additions & 0 deletions Package.swift
@@ -0,0 +1,22 @@
// swift-tools-version:5.0
import PackageDescription

let package = Package(
name: "ReadWriteLock",

platforms: [
.iOS("8.0"),
.macOS("10.10"),
.tvOS("9.0"),
.watchOS("2.0")
],

products: [
.library(name: "ReadWriteLock", targets: ["ReadWriteLock"])
],

targets: [
.target(name: "ReadWriteLock", path: "ReadWriteLock"),
.testTarget(name: "ReadWriteLockTests", dependencies: ["ReadWriteLock"], path: "ReadWriteLockTests")
]
)
2 changes: 1 addition & 1 deletion ReadWriteLock.podspec
@@ -1,7 +1,7 @@
Pod::Spec.new do |s|

s.name = "ReadWriteLock"
s.version = "1.0.0"
s.version = "1.0.1"
s.summary = "A Swifty Read-Write lock"
s.description = <<-DESC
A lightweight framework of a safe an easy implementation of a read-write lock for iOS, macOS, tvOS, and watchOS.
Expand Down
Expand Up @@ -15,7 +15,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F755E922A8CD03002E11D4"
BuildableName = "ReadWriteLock_macO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ock macO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and Down Expand Up @@ -54,7 +54,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F755E922A8CD03002E11D4"
BuildableName = "ReadWriteLock_macO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ock macO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and All @@ -76,7 +76,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F755E922A8CD03002E11D4"
BuildableName = "ReadWriteLock_macO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ock macO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and All @@ -94,7 +94,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F755E922A8CD03002E11D4"
BuildableName = "ReadWriteLock_macO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ock macO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and Down
Expand Up @@ -15,7 +15,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F7560522A8CD18002E11D4"
BuildableName = "ReadWriteLock_tvO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ock tvO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and Down Expand Up @@ -54,7 +54,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F7560522A8CD18002E11D4"
BuildableName = "ReadWriteLock_tvO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ock tvO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and All @@ -76,7 +76,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F7560522A8CD18002E11D4"
BuildableName = "ReadWriteLock_tvO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ock tvO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and All @@ -94,7 +94,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F7560522A8CD18002E11D4"
BuildableName = "ReadWriteLock_tvO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ock tvO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and Down
Expand Up @@ -15,7 +15,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F7562122A8CD2A002E11D4"
BuildableName = "ReadWriteLock_watchO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ock watchO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and Down Expand Up @@ -46,7 +46,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F7562122A8CD2A002E11D4"
BuildableName = "ReadWriteLock_watchO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ock watchO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and All @@ -64,7 +64,7 @@
<BuildableReference
BuildableIdentifier = "primary"
BlueprintIdentifier = "DDF7562122A8CD2A002E11D4"
BuildableName = "ReadWriteLock_watchOS.framework"
BuildableName = "ReadWriteLock.framework"
BlueprintName = "ReadWriteLock watchOS"
ReferencedContainer = "container:ReadWriteLock.xcodeproj">
</BuildableReference>
Expand Down

0 comments on commit 1fd367e

Please sign in to comment.